Carnatic singer, Bombay Jayashree has been nominated in the Best Original Song category for the Pi lullaby in Ang Lee’s Life of Pi. The Chennai-based singer who is elated at the honour bestowed upon her says, “I am too tired and dazed to react to this news. It is simply fantastic. It will take some time for the news to sink in.”

Regarding her contribution to the film, the singer feels that it was perhaps fate that music director Mychael Danna and director Ang Lee happened to listen to one of her records. Though unable to understand the lyrics, the duo, however, immediately connected with the mellifluous quality and tenor in her voice. “Both Danna and Lee were very clear about what they wanted from me. They came to India and spent a few days during which we discussed the lyrics. The lullaby connects to the story and is an intrinsic part. The song is not placed anywhere just for the sake of it, which adds to its value,” explains the singer.
